Highlights of Cai Be Floating Market
Exploring the Cai Be Floating Market is a highlight of the Mekong Delta tour that offers a vibrant glimpse into daily life along the river.
Here, boats laden with fresh fruits, vegetables, and local delicacies create a bustling atmosphere. Travelers can witness traders showcasing their goods on bamboo poles, making it easy to spot what’s for sale.
Don’t miss sampling tropical fruits or trying some homemade treats like coconut candy! Engaging with local vendors provides a unique cultural insight and a chance to practice some Vietnamese phrases.
It’s best to arrive early to soak in the lively energy and snag the freshest produce. Grab your camera—this dynamic market scene is an unforgettable slice of Vietnamese life!
Itinerary and Tour Experience
What can travelers expect from a day in the Mekong Delta?
They’ll kick things off early, leaving Ho Chi Minh City by 7:30 am for an adventure filled with sights and flavors.
First up is the bustling Cai Be Floating Market, where colorful boats sell everything from fruits to local delicacies.
After soaking in the market vibes, it’s a scenic motorboat ride through tranquil canals.
Here, visitors can peek into local workshops, learning how traditional cakes and coconut products are made.
Sampling fresh tropical fruits is a must, and a delicious Vietnamese lunch on an island wraps up the experience nicely.
It’s a day packed with culture, tasty treats, and unforgettable memories in the heart of Vietnam’s waterways.

Meeting Points and Pickup Details
For travelers gearing up for a Mekong Delta adventure, knowing the meeting points and pickup details can make all the difference.
Tourists can expect a hassle-free start as pickup occurs right from their hotel in District 1 or District 3. If they prefer, they can also meet at SinhBalo Adventure Travel, located at 283, 20 Phạm Ngũ Lão, District 1.
It’s just a short 200-meter walk from the last bus station on Phạm Ngũ Lão street, making it accessible via public transport. The tour kicks off at 7:30 am, so it’s wise to arrive a bit early.
With a maximum group size of eight, it promises a more intimate experience as they explore the vibrant Mekong Delta together.
